ooiior-31-inch-electric-fireplace-recessHow a Wall Mounted Electric Fire Works

You should understand the way an electric fireplace operates if you plan to install one in your home. They are simple to install, no chimney is required, and are energy efficient.

Before installing, locate an area that is close enough to an outlet to be able to reach the power cord and has sufficient clearance from nearby material that could ignite.

Easy to install

Compared to a traditional gas fireplace which requires annual inspections and is prone to carbon monoxide leaks wall mounted electric fires are relatively straightforward to install. They don't require chimneys, which makes them a good option for homes with a small space. There are a few things you should think about before buying one. For instance it is recommended that you keep all combustible items at least three feet away from the fireplace. This will reduce the chance of fire and also to ensure that the fireplace is safe to use. Additionally, you must be sure that the circulation of hot air isn't blocked. Also, you must check whether the electric fireplace is wired or not. If it is not connected, the fireplace will not start and will appear dark. You should also check the outlet and circuit breaker to determine if it has been not tripped.

No chimney required

Electric fireplaces don't require a chimney or any other ventilation system. This makes them an excellent alternative for homes that do not have chimneys or who want the appearance of a fireplace but without the cost and maintenance of gas fireplaces.

turbro-in-flames-28-inch-vertical-wall-mInstallation of a wall fireplaces electric-mounted electrical fire is easy and can be completed in a couple of easy steps. The majority of electric fires come with mounting brackets as well as a set of instructions. In general, the instructions will tell you to fit the brackets first and then place the firebox in the space. Some models have a screen that allows you to adjust the settings. The manual will explain how far away the heater should be from the combustibles.

When installing a wall-mounted electric fire it is essential to think about where the power cable will be situated. The electric fireplace usually has a plug socket which you will need connect to an outlet. Make sure the socket is accessible and is not hidden behind the fire.

Before you begin installing your fireplace, it is recommended to test it to make sure that everything is working as it should. Connecting it to the electrical outlet will allow you to test whether the flame effect display is turned on and that the heater is functioning. Some fireplaces with electric features come with remote controls that let you operate them from a distance.

Some people prefer to hang their electric fires at eye level from a seated position, which is about 42" off the ground. Others prefer to install them higher, such as between their wall mounted TV and the floor or over their sofa. It's all about individual preference, but make sure that the fireplace meets all requirements for installation before hanging. Also, make sure that it is securely hung and not loose or unstable. For this purpose, it is better to use wooden studs than plastic anchors.

Low maintenance

In comparison to gas fires which can be expensive to run electric wall-mounted fires are cheaper and more energy efficient. They don't require an chimney or pipework. They plug into any standard power outlet and can be moved around the home depending on the need. This makes them a great alternative for those who can't install a traditional fireplace in their home or for those with children who are concerned about the risk of an open flame.

Many of these fireplaces also come with remote controls that let you adjust the flame effects, the ember bed, and the lighting settings without having to leave your chair or couch. They are also easy to clean. You should not place your electric fireplace too close to combustible material like curtains or wood furniture. This will avoid overheating or a failure of the electrical system.

Some fireplaces feature glowing embers that resemble the real flame. They come with a range of different settings for the flames and the ember bed, which includes LED lighting effects. Additionally, certain models include a gentle source of supplemental heat that can be activated independently of the main flame effect.

The simplicity of wall-mounted fires is the main reason for choosing it. It is simple to install and requires only a little technical knowledge. It is also very safe. Contrary to a gas fireplace with a flue an electric fire doesn't produce any dangerous fumes or toxic substances.
